Perrigo Company (PRGO) Q2 2024 earnings summary

8 Jul, 2026Executive summary
Q2 2024 net sales declined 10.7% year-over-year to $1.07 billion, mainly due to lower infant formula and seasonal categories, but margin expansion and cost savings initiatives like Project Energize and Supply Chain Reinvention offset topline impacts.
Adjusted diluted EPS was $0.53, down from $0.63 in Q2 2023, primarily due to prior year tax benefits and infant formula impact.
Project Energize delivered $53 million in gross savings year-to-date, targeting $140–$170 million annualized pre-tax savings by 2026.
Completed divestment of HRA Pharma Rare Diseases business in July 2024, with $205 million in proceeds and related impairment charges recognized in Q2.
Investments in brand building, leadership talent, and innovation are strengthening consumer focus and future growth prospects.
Financial highlights
Q2 2024 organic net sales declined 9.1% year-over-year, with -6.8ppts from infant formula and -4.0ppts from lower Upper Respiratory and Pain & Sleep Aids, partially offset by +1.7ppts growth elsewhere.
Adjusted gross margin rose 190 bps to 40.6%; adjusted operating margin up 160 bps to 13.1% year-over-year.
Adjusted operating income was $139 million, up 1.5% year-over-year; adjusted net income was $74 million.
GAAP operating loss was $27 million, with reported net loss of $106 million, or $(0.77) per diluted share, due to impairment and restructuring charges.
Cash and cash equivalents at quarter-end were $543 million, excluding $205 million from HRA Pharma divestment.
Outlook and guidance
Fiscal 2024 organic net sales growth outlook revised to -3% to -1%; total net sales growth now -5% to -3%.
Adjusted diluted EPS guidance reaffirmed at $2.50–$2.65 for fiscal 2024; second half EPS expected to more than double first half.
Margin expansion and lower variable expenses are expected to offset net sales headwinds, supporting confidence in EPS guidance.
Projected operating cash flow conversion of 90–100% and plans to pay down $400 million in debt by year-end, reducing net leverage to 3.8x–4.0x.
Estimated year-end cash balance $500M–$550M; interest expense expected at ~$180 million; adjusted tax rate ~20.5%.
